Expand each expressions and combine like terms if possible
-12(5/6x - 5) + 2x​

Answer:

The answer is

60 - 8x

Step-by-step explanation:

[tex] - 12( \frac{5}{6} x - 5) + 2x[/tex]

Using FOIL multiply the terms in the bracket

That's

[tex] - 12( \frac{5}{6} x) + 12(5) + 2x \\ \rarr \: \: - 10x + 60 + 2x[/tex]

Group like terms

That's

[tex]60 + 2x - 10x[/tex]

We have the final answer as

60 - 8x
